Celebrity Big Brother Tension Explodes as Tiffany Accuses Trisha of Throwing Shade Backstage

Photo by ITV/Rex

The drama didn’t stop when Trisha Goddard walked out of the Celebrity Big Brother house — in fact, it seems to have just kicked off. The TV veteran, who was recently evicted from the ITV series, found herself in a seriously awkward moment with CBB legend Tiffany Pollard during a spin-off show appearance, and now we finally know what caused the on-air tension.

Trisha, 67, had joined Late & Live alongside Tiffany, 43, and from the moment they sat down, viewers could tell something was off. Things took a turn when Tiffany suddenly brought up what happened backstage, saying: “That’s why you were so rude to me upstairs during the debriefing when you told me that I was small, because you felt at home to be rude to the HBIC.”

Trisha laughed it off and tried to change the subject, saying, “We’ll talk about that later, Tiffany,” but the vibe got even icier when Tiffany responded with a sarcastic, “She plays such a good game, the game is still on, Trisha.”

Now, Tiffany’s finally spilled the beans on what went down. Speaking to The Sun’s Celebrity Big Brother Breakdown podcast, she claimed Trisha made a sly dig about her role during the pre-show briefing. “They were explaining my segment to me, and I was gonna be a news anchor. She was like, ‘Oh, but it’ll be a very small-time news anchor,’” Tiffany said.

Not one to let things slide, she fired back: “Do not throw shade up here at me; wait till we go downstairs and the cameras are on us because we can really go at it.” Trisha, according to Tiffany, tried to backtrack by saying it was actually a compliment, suggesting that being a “small-town, small-time TV host” meant you were good at what you do — but Tiffany wasn’t buying it. “You would think it was shade when she said it,” she added.

Despite the behind-the-scenes fallout, Trisha has kept things light in public. After her eviction, she spoke about how important the show was for her personally. Having been diagnosed with terminal breast cancer, she described her time in the CBB house as a much-needed break from treatment and constant worry. “It meant a lot—it was respite… I didn’t have to think of the next scan,” she said.

But if Trisha thought the house was intense, it seems the real fireworks started the minute she left.
